Transaction e2c442708bf96c91e3a993defc962874d99630f100688ad83bd450ecb02b7c81
1 Input
1 Output
-
e2c442708bf96c91e3a993defc962874d99630f100688ad83bd450ecb02b7c81:0
- value
- 63276493
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 992a8a7bae486dd8309e683d778513ba4345dd80 OP_EQUAL
- address
- 3FetGh29ancYf7KJRF3UPZmi2mutbU2mUX